| Noctua NH-D14 Heatsink Review Cooling a processor can be a real challenge when you are looking for good performance with a minimum of noise. Typically you'll have to sacrifice something along the way. High performance normally means a higher noise threshold, while quiet heatsinks usually don't cool very well. http://www.ninjalane.com/reviews/cooling/noctua_nh-d14
